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7792241 85 326158
7307 0066232 25914857
7307 0066232 25914857
850813879 7551436048 9428906311
All about undefined
Interested in learning more?
7307 0066232 25914857
850813879 7551436048 9428906311
See more
998855 74 77876000
94 551 40 867318471
See more
5242798218 87 1872
63 77069680 903 49088 139856
See more